    UltraSlim in Perth: A Comprehensive Look at Safety

    UltraSlim, a revolutionary non-invasive body contouring treatment, has gained significant attention in Perth for its ability to reduce fat and tighten skin without surgery. But the question on many potential clients' minds is: Is it safe?

    Safety is paramount in any medical procedure, and UltraSlim is no exception. The treatment utilizes a combination of ultrasound and radiofrequency technologies to target and eliminate fat cells while promoting skin tightening. These technologies have been extensively studied and are FDA-cleared, indicating a high level of safety and efficacy.

    In Perth, UltraSlim treatments are typically administered by certified professionals who have undergone specialized training. This ensures that the procedure is performed correctly, minimizing any potential risks. Common side effects are usually mild and may include temporary redness, swelling, or tingling in the treated area, which typically resolve within a few hours to a couple of days.

    However, as with any medical treatment, there are certain considerations. Individuals with certain medical conditions, such as pregnancy, active infections, or certain skin conditions, may not be suitable candidates for UltraSlim. It's crucial to have a thorough consultation with a qualified practitioner to assess your individual health status and determine if UltraSlim is the right choice for you.

    In summary, UltraSlim in Perth is generally considered safe when performed by trained professionals and when appropriate patient screening is conducted. Always seek a consultation to understand the specifics of the procedure and to ensure it aligns with your health and wellness goals.

    Understanding the Safety of UltraSlim in Perth

    UltraSlim in Perth has emerged as a leading non-invasive body contouring treatment, offering individuals a safe and effective alternative to surgical procedures. As a medical professional, I am often asked about the safety of this treatment, and I am pleased to provide a detailed explanation based on current medical knowledge and clinical experience.

    The Technology Behind UltraSlim

    UltraSlim utilizes a combination of ultrasound and radiofrequency technologies to achieve its results. Ultrasound energy is known for its ability to target specific layers of fat cells without causing damage to surrounding tissues. Radiofrequency, on the other hand, helps to tighten the skin and promote collagen production, enhancing the overall appearance of the treated area. Both of these technologies have been extensively studied and are recognized for their safety and efficacy in medical and aesthetic applications.

    Clinical Safety Studies

    Numerous clinical studies have been conducted to assess the safety of UltraSlim. These studies have consistently shown that the treatment is well-tolerated by patients, with minimal side effects reported. Commonly observed side effects include temporary redness, mild swelling, and tenderness in the treated area, all of which typically resolve within a few days. More serious side effects are extremely rare and have not been reported in the extensive body of research available.

    Patient Selection and Pre-Treatment Assessment

    The safety of UltraSlim is also dependent on proper patient selection and thorough pre-treatment assessment. During the initial consultation, a qualified medical professional will evaluate the patient's medical history, current health status, and suitability for the treatment. This ensures that only those who are good candidates for the procedure proceed, thereby minimizing any potential risks.

    Post-Treatment Care and Follow-Up

    Post-treatment care is another critical aspect of ensuring the safety and success of UltraSlim. Patients are provided with detailed instructions on how to care for the treated area, including recommendations for hydration, physical activity, and skincare. Regular follow-up appointments are scheduled to monitor the patient's progress and address any concerns that may arise.

    Conclusion

    In conclusion, UltraSlim in Perth is a safe and effective option for those seeking to contour their body without the need for invasive surgery. The combination of ultrasound and radiofrequency technologies, backed by extensive clinical research and careful patient selection, ensures that the treatment is both safe and well-tolerated. As with any medical procedure, it is important to choose a reputable provider and follow all pre- and post-treatment guidelines to achieve the best possible results.

    Understanding the Safety of UltraSlim in Perth

    UltraSlim is a non-invasive treatment that has gained popularity in Perth for its ability to provide noticeable body contouring results without the need for surgery. As a medical professional, it is crucial to address the safety concerns associated with this procedure to ensure that patients make informed decisions.

    Non-Invasive Technology

    UltraSlim utilizes advanced LED light technology to target fat cells, causing them to release their contents and shrink. This process, known as photobiomodulation, is non-invasive, meaning there are no incisions, needles, or anesthesia involved. The non-invasive nature of UltraSlim significantly reduces the risk of complications typically associated with surgical procedures.

    Clinical Studies and Safety Data

    Numerous clinical studies have been conducted to evaluate the safety and efficacy of UltraSlim. These studies have consistently shown that the procedure is well-tolerated by patients, with minimal side effects reported. Commonly observed side effects include temporary redness and mild tenderness at the treatment site, which typically resolve within a few hours.

    Professional Administration

    The safety of UltraSlim is also dependent on the expertise of the practitioner administering the treatment. In Perth, it is essential to choose a clinic that employs certified professionals who have undergone proper training in the use of UltraSlim technology. A qualified practitioner will conduct a thorough consultation to assess the patient's suitability for the treatment and ensure that all safety protocols are followed.

    Patient Suitability and Expectations

    While UltraSlim is generally safe for most individuals, it is not suitable for everyone. Patients with certain medical conditions, such as pregnancy, active cancer, or recent surgeries, may not be eligible for the treatment. It is crucial for patients to have realistic expectations about the results. UltraSlim is not a weight-loss solution but rather a method for body contouring and reducing localized fat deposits.

    Conclusion

    In summary, UltraSlim in Perth is a safe and effective non-invasive treatment for body contouring. The procedure's non-invasive nature, backed by clinical studies, and administered by qualified professionals, significantly reduces the risk of complications. However, it is essential for patients to undergo a thorough consultation to ensure they are suitable candidates and have realistic expectations about the outcomes. By choosing a reputable clinic and following the practitioner's guidelines, patients can enjoy the benefits of UltraSlim with peace of mind.

    Understanding the Safety of UltraSlim in Perth

    UltraSlim is a cutting-edge technology that has gained significant attention in the field of medical aesthetics, particularly in Perth. As a medical professional, it is my duty to provide you with a comprehensive understanding of the safety aspects associated with this treatment.

    What is UltraSlim?

    UltraSlim is a non-invasive procedure that utilizes red light therapy to promote fat reduction and skin tightening. The technology works by penetrating the skin with specific wavelengths of light, which are absorbed by the fat cells. This absorption causes the cells to release their contents, which are then naturally processed and eliminated by the body.

    Safety Protocols and Standards

    The safety of UltraSlim is backed by rigorous scientific research and clinical studies. In Perth, all medical aesthetic procedures, including UltraSlim, are subject to stringent regulatory standards. These standards ensure that the equipment used is of the highest quality and that the practitioners administering the treatments are fully trained and certified.

    Potential Side Effects

    While UltraSlim is generally considered safe, as with any medical procedure, there are potential side effects that patients should be aware of. These may include temporary redness, mild swelling, or tingling sensations at the treatment site. However, these effects are usually mild and resolve on their own within a few hours to a couple of days.

    Patient Suitability

    Not all individuals are suitable candidates for UltraSlim. It is crucial to undergo a thorough consultation with a qualified medical professional to determine if this treatment is appropriate for you. Factors such as skin type, medical history, and personal goals will be considered to ensure the best possible outcome and safety.

    Post-Treatment Care

    Proper post-treatment care is essential to maximize the benefits of UltraSlim and ensure safety. Patients are advised to stay hydrated, maintain a healthy diet, and avoid excessive sun exposure. Additionally, following the practitioner's guidelines on skincare and lifestyle adjustments can help maintain the results achieved.

    In conclusion, UltraSlim in Perth is a safe and effective treatment when administered by qualified professionals and under the appropriate conditions. By understanding the technology, adhering to safety protocols, and following post-treatment care instructions, patients can achieve their aesthetic goals with confidence.
